The Introduction

The first thing that seemed out of place in the video was not that they were creating the video with a low-quality camera, but the people in them. As you will notice, the Click Money Founders are Julia and Harold. With no last name: how convenient. Even if you try to search up a Harold and Julia in the UK, you have no way of knowing which Harold and which Julia you should be looking at. This was the first indication of the Click Money System scam. Another thing that you should note is the number of spots left indicated at the top right. It remains constant at 10. No matter how much time you spend on the website or how many times you refresh it, the number remains constant. This is highly at odds with the pop up that comes up when you try to leave the page.

Is the Click Money System a Scam?

As we noted in our Click Money System review, the number of people being shown in the pop up as well as the number of people who are trying to sign up displacing a potential customer is very high. Not only that, the number varies very erratically, giving a good impression of a lot of activity taking place on the website. If that is indeed the case, then why is the number of places left for signing up stuck at 10?

Another thing that we noted, indicating a Click Money System scam was the fact that the countdown timer showing how long till the link expires resets. It starts counting down from 5 minutes and as soon as it reaches 00:00, it goes back to 5:00. If this was actually a real limited opportunity, this link would have expired and not let you sign up. Instead, as can be noted, it is simply a fraudulent case where you have no dearth of chances. The whole thing is simply a convenient ploy to get users to sign up quickly.
